My first BMW was a 1989 K100RS. It had nothing like the power of the Japanese bikes I’d been riding, but it had ABS and I loved it. (At that time everybody else was making fun of BMW, saying ABS on a bike was ridiculous…. And not long after that, Harley sued several law enforcement agencies that specified ABS on their purchase solicitations, because nobody but BMW offered ABS. Now, of course, everybody offers ABS.)
After the K100RS I discovered boxers, first in RTs, and then GSs. I missed the Japanese horsepower and long service intervals, but the BMWs were so effortless to ride fast and long, and they held a deep line in a corner without any continuing control input. Maybe it’s just me, but it felt like I could set the lean and just let go — and I could do it for 500 or 600 miles at a stretch without feeling like I got my ass kicked the next day.
I put a lot of miles on my second GS, a gray 2008 GSA (below). I loved every mile, but when I saw the K1600GT I really wanted it. Beautiful, comfortable, and with over 160 HP, fast. My wife and I put 245 miles on the store’s demo bike one weekend — so I ordered one. Unfortunately, I couldn’t part with the GS…. And I couldn’t afford the 1600 without selling the GS, so I added a Kawasaki Connie 1400 to the stable to fill the gap. That was another bad decision. It was very fast in a straight line, but it had terrible brakes and cornering compared to the BMW, so I sold it after less than 2000 miles. Hated it, really. (I know lots of folks love the Connies…)
After 10 years with the old GSA I finally replaced it with a blue and white 2018 GSA, which I still have. With traction control off it easily wheelies, though I’m getting too old for that. Also too old for the Husky 701… I dropped a tooth on the 701s front sprocket before even riding it — because I knew I’d never ride that bike at 90 mph, so I figured I’d improve low-end grunt. Bad decision. The bike already had unlimited low end grunt… it wanted to wheelie at every speed.
